Make your characters stand out.
As writers, we have the increasingly difficult job of making our characters stand on their own two feet. Now we have to make them stand out too.
Even identical twins have their own distinct personalities, and that should be the same for your characters as well.
Today’s exercise is easy.
Come up with dialogue. You don’t even have to come up with it yourself. Find quotes or pick some out of whatever is playing on TV right now. Close your eyes and think of which character would say what.
If you can clearly hear them, and distinguish them from the others, then congratulations! Your characters stand out.
